It was held from 9 June to 9 July in Germany, which had won the right to host the event in July Teams representing national football associations from all six populated continents participated in the qualification process which began in September Thirty-one teams qualified from this process along with hosts Germany for the finals tournament. It was the second time that Germany staged the competition and the first as a unified country along with the former East Germany with Leipzig as a host city the other was in in West Germany , and the 10th time that the tournament was held in Europe. Italy won the tournament, claiming their fourth World Cup title, defeating France 5—3 in a penalty shoot-out in the final after extra time had finished in a 1—1 draw. Germany defeated Portugal 3—1 to finish in third place. It was also the only appearance of Serbia and Montenegro under that name; they had previously appeared in as Yugoslavia.

The match was played at the Olympiastadion in Berlin , Germany, on 9 July , and was contested between Italy and France. The event comprised hosts Germany and 31 other teams who emerged from the qualification phase , organised by the six FIFA confederations. The 32 teams competed in a group stage, from which 16 teams qualified for the knockout stage. En route to the final, Italy finished first in Group E , with two wins and a draw, after which they defeated Australia in the round of 16, Ukraine in the quarter-final and Germany 2—0, in the semi-final. France finished runner-up of Group G with one win and two draws, before defeating Spain in the round of 16, Brazil in the quarter-final and Portugal 1—0 in the semi-final. The final was witnessed by 69, spectators in the stadium, with the referee for the match being Horacio Elizondo from Argentina. Italy won the World Cup after beating France 5—3 in a penalty shoot-out following a 1—1 draw at the conclusion of extra time. The match was focused mostly on France's Zinedine Zidane and Italy's Marco Materazzi : this was the last match of Zidane's career, they each scored their team's only goal of the game and they were also involved in an incident in extra time that led to Zidane being sent off for headbutting Materazzi in the chest. The incident was the subject of much analysis following the match. Italy's Andrea Pirlo was named the man of the match, and Zidane was awarded the Golden Ball as the best player of the tournament. Italy's victory was their first world title in 24 years, and their fourth overall, putting them one ahead of Germany and only one behind Brazil. The Olympiastadion in Berlin was used as the venue for the final, as well as five other matches over the tournament.

A complex personality who has struggled to win over French fans since taking over from Jacques Santini after Euro , Domenech was subjected to a barrage of criticism as his team made hard work of their qualifying campaign. He was widely blamed for the early retirements of Zinedine Zidane, Claude Makelele and Lilian Thuram, all of whom subsequently reversed their decisions. Survived a torrid early World Cup campaign accusing the media of sabotage and attracting a storm of criticism over his tactics and decision to substitute Zidane in the draw with South Korea. The win over Togo was crucial in improving the atmosphere and with Zidane back after suspension, Les Bleus suddenly rediscovered all their old inspiration to trounce Spain and then shock the world by dethroning Brazil. Playing in his third World Cup, Henry more than any other player in the French squad is out to make his mark on the tournament after a poor showing in where he failed to score a goal.
